Spedition Ansorge GmbH & Co. KG has relied on high-quality trailers from Burtenbach for years. The current Ansorge fleet, over 90 per cent of which consists of Kögel vehicles, has also undergone a massive upgrade this year. During the summer, 80 new Kögel Cargo Rail trailers with paper equipment were added and, very recently, Ansorge Logistik ordered 28 Kögel Combi swap body trailers at IAA Commercial Vehicles.

Kögel Cargo Rail with paper equipment

The trailers designed for multi-modal haulage are equipped with a reinforced chassis frame. The gripper edges integrated into the frame and a gripper jaw tarpaulin protection made from aramid fabric allow the Cargo Rail trailers to be loaded onto rails. Kögel Cargo Rail has thus been designed for flexible loading on the most prevalent rail pocket wagons. For optimal load-securing, 13 pairs of lashing rings are available within the VarioFix perforated steel external frame, each ring affording 2,000 kg of tensile force. The interiors of the front wall are also optionally reinforced with a two millimetre thick and 1,000 millimetre high galvanised steel plate for added protection of the front wall. The trailers are, of course, certified in accordance with DIN EN 12642 Code XL.

In order to equip them for the transport of paper rolls, there are four longitudinal aluminium loading rails with an integrated hole arrangement for load-securing with locking wedges during loading and unloading. So that the paper rolls remain dry, at Ansorge Logistik individual equipment, such as tarpaulin with an additional water barrier, is used in the area of the gripper edges and splash guard covers for the 13 pairs of lashing rings in the external frame.

Kögel Combi

With the 28 Kögel Combi swap body trailers, Ansorge Logistik has opted for an intelligent commercial vehicle solution. Thanks to a plug-in and folding standard stop, the chassis are the optimum solution for the transport of swap bodies of all types. With a tare weight upward of 2.7 tonnes and a light but still stable frame construction, the swap body chassis are suitable for high payloads. The optimised axle geometry guarantees excellent road handling and tracking during empty trips. For better everyday handling, the swap bodies can be raised and lowered even without a tractor unit by means of lateral control levers and an adequate air supply. Plug-in guide rollers also assist in precise swap body underriding.

"As a loyal Kögel customer, for us it was clear from the outset that we would rely on Kögel trailers when expanding our fleet", says Wolfgang Thoma, managing partner of Ansorge Logistik. "During the summer, we have already received 80 Kögel Cargo Rail trailers. Now our swap body trailers fleet needed an update and of course our path on this front, too, led us to Kögel."
